WORK Emotion Kiwami - 18x9.5 on Subaru BRZ
WORK Emotion Kiwami - 18x9.5 from WORK Japan on BRZ.
Spec: 18x9.5 +30mm all around Tire Spec: 225/40 front and 245/35 Rear Coil Over Installed
